1. Inoculations
Vaccines assist your pet dog's body immune system by teaching it to acknowledge disease-causing agents. They stop several serious illness that were as soon as dangerous, and they conserve pet parents cash by preventing costly therapies.
Pups are called for to be vaccinated against distemper, adenovirus 1, and parvovirus. These extremely transmittable conditions can cause secondary infections, dehydration, and death in unvaccinated young puppies and pet dogs.
Various other "non-core" injections that you could require for your pet include kennel cough (Bordetella bronchiseptica), influenza, leptospirosis, and Lyme illness (Borrelia burgdorferi). The latter is especially crucial for pets that hang around outdoors because ticks carry this fatal illness.
Ask your veterinarian regarding inoculation demands for your pet dog prior to enrolling in childcare. Your veterinarian may also recommend temperament tests to ensure your pet is safe around other canines.

3. Feeding Schedule
A well-planned meal feeding schedule aids guarantee your canine eats the proper quantity of food and stays clear of overindulging. It likewise makes it easier to detect when your pet dog isn't really feeling well.
Adult dogs can be fed twice a day, preferably at 8-12 hours apart. Youthful puppies generally need 3 dishes a day, as they have a much more sensitive digestive system.
It's ideal to load your canine's usual food for their boarding or childcare remain. This will help them feel a lot more in your home and acquainted with dog boarding for aggressive dogs near me their environment and nutritional requirements.
Make sure to label each bag or container with the daycare staff's feeding guidelines, including amounts and times. It's additionally practical to include a few of your pet's favored treats that will make them really feel special.

5. Medication
Several pet dogs require medicines for a variety of factors. It's important for customers to pack enough of their pet dog's routine medication to last throughout the remain and to include a thorough routine with clear dosage directions.
This consists of prescription medicine, yet also vitamins and supplements. It's additionally important for customers to bring flea and tick prevention and any other recurring health therapies suggested by their vet.
A wellness appointment is a must prior to a pet's boarding or daycare remain. It allows a veterinarian to analyze the condition of the pet and establish any type of essential vaccinations or bloodsucker prevention before it's required. This prevents any type of unforeseen health and wellness problems or medication reactions that can negatively affect the pet's experience at a boarding or daycare facility. It's additionally an opportunity for clients to ask inquiries and discuss any type of problems they have with their veterinarian.
